Name generator python, What is a Python Generator (Textbook Definition) A Python generator is a function which returns a generator iterator (just an object we can iterate over) by calling yield . Camelcase is a programming language that allows you to name files or functions without breaking the underlying language's naming rules. The first bit of code grabs a disctionary The challenge Write a function, nicknameGenerator that takes a string name as an argument and returns the first 3 or 4 letters as a nickname. The project's github page has lots of more advanced code snippets if you decide Print… In our last Python Tutorial, we studied Python functions. If “numOfNames” is 2 then call “giveMeBabyName” function 2 times and In the quick video, I show you how to generate random names in Python. yield may be called with a value, in which case that value is treated as the 'generated' value. odds of making nfl playoffs by record » how much do mbbs interns get paid » chris paul 2k20 build. Nicknames, cool fonts, symbols and tags for Python001. TableName can be a single table name, > or a comma-separated list of names for a join. Descent. Also learn how to create and use them along with various use cases. In all, the 'random. March 23, 2022;. import namegenerator #First Do pip install namegenerator #The Import it print (namegenerator. * d/control: Update Vcs-* fields with new Debian Python Team Salsa layout. “numOfNames” parameter’s data type is integer which is the number of baby names user want to see. Generators in Python — Edureka. A Generator can have more than one yield statement. Generating iterables or objects that allow stepping over them is considered to be a burdensome task. - GitHub - navchandar/Python-Random-Name-Generator: Python data provider module that returns random people names, addresses, state names, country names as output. 0-2) unstable; urgency=medium [ Ondřej Nový ] * d/control: Update Maintainer field with new Debian Python Team contact address. dom Yield 10. dom Generators in python are a type of iterators that are used to execute generator functions using the next () function. I have this stub file that I need help with. from xml. But making the two lists was a bit of effort and I thought others might want to make use of them. randrange method. Where python3 is a keyword used, we have used the path of a file having the In our last Python Tutorial, we studied Python functions. Extract the ZIP into a file. If you are using a Python version higher than 3. "Aedar", "Moglar") to create random names. The package can be simple installed via pip: pip install python-random-name-generator. For my first Python project, I created a brand name generator that asks the user a set of questions, sets their answers as variables, and prints out a response. In my case I only want the 1 character to be a capital so I'll set it to you 1. org/project/names/ Download Random-Name-Generator Using Python -Tkinter desktop application project in Python with source code . import random def name_array (file): # open file with names with open (file) as fp: new_list = [] # loop through each line in the txt file for line in fp: # remove white spaces next to each name and add # to the new_list array new_list. The PyPI package python-random-name-generator receives a total of 69 downloads a week. I just came across generators in Python. X. 1 2 3. Installing Python. If the string is less than 4 characters,… Read More »How to create a Nickname Generator in Python I want to generate usernames based on: Last 3 letters of a first name. Run the command “ python3 ” Step 2: Create A Greeting Once you figure out your greeting, place it in the quotation marks inside of the parentheses. 1, no changes needed. txt" female_names = name_array (file) file = "last Library for Python to generate a list of random names. 3. Command Line Usage. ") square = next(gen) print(square) All I want to do is pick a random line, between [part1] and [part2], and then another random line between [part2] and the end of the file, and concatenate the two together (e. The Code Name generator currently can create over 55,669 unique results. org/project/names/ Python answers related to “generate random names in python” how to make a module that generates a random letter in python; print random string from list python Download Random-Name-Generator Using Python -Tkinter desktop application project in Python with source code . > """generator which does an SQL query which can return 0 or more > result rows, yielding each record in turn as a mapping from > field name to field value. Ask Question Asked 5 years, 2 months ago. As such, we scored python-random-name-generator popularity level to be Limited. choice (last_name) print ' '. Back . For this project, I am using a Centos7 server with Virtual Studio Code installed using a cloud playground server from A Cloud Guru. To do this first we need to set the number of characters we want to be capitalized. Python name generator. in the above example, we return a random integer between 1 and 10. dom Learn what are generators in Python along with the advantages. upper_case = 1. The script is super simple and I have posted it as a GitHub Gist so I won’t describe it all again here. If “numOfNames” is 2 then call “giveMeBabyName” function 2 times and Example 1: random name generator in python import namegenerator #First Do pip install namegenerator #The Import it print (namegenerator. So, color-oriented names certainly deserve consideration. append (random. choice(). Can anyone explain to me it in simple words? Nicknames, cool fonts, symbols and tags for Python001. Then to create random names just do: import names for i in range(10): print(names. Below the markdown description of the function is an actual Python file you can grab, or grab it from here. Extra allows > specification of order/group clauses. random. """ I want to generate usernames based on: Last 3 letters of a first name. Just lower the name count. # generator object with next () I want to generate usernames based on: Last 3 letters of a first name. Usage. To obtain the output on Linux, go to the Ubuntu terminal and write the following command: $ python3 ‘ / home / aqsa / Documents / resulttemp. In the previous code, we activate the function multiply (), and assign it to a What is a Python Generator (Textbook Definition) A Python generator is a function which returns a generator iterator (just an object we can iterate over) by calling yield . 4. 5. Github - Faker Install Faker The simplest way to install Faker is by using pip pip install Faker Examples Here's a few examples to get you started. Use secrets. Create a Random Name Generator App 2. choice() function instead of random. ENGLISH, sex = rng. txt" male_names = name_array (file) file = "female_first_names. Thanks for watching!The package info can be found here - https://pypi. choices () method. The following code is written for Python3. Complete random name function in next file. The year a student is enrolled in. The methods to generate a random sentence are as follows: Using essential-generators. Python data provider module that returns random people names, addresses, state names, country names as output. Browse Bootcamps Generators in Python — Edureka. g. Azul. generate (descent = rng. choice method. python generator object. Where python3 is a keyword used, we have used the path of a file having the We can get random elements from a list, tuple, or sets. individual_word = text. Training in Top Yield 10. A good idea for a startup company or for anyone who needs to assign a codename to something. choice ()' function will need to be called 6 times. In our last Python Tutorial, we studied Python functions. we can also generate a list of random numbers between 1 and 10 using the list comprehension method. This module is also useful to shuffle the elements. dom The script is super simple and I have posted it as a GitHub Gist so I won’t describe it all again here. split () print (individual_word) To make it randomly generate names you will have to use the randint, now and print to see randomly generated words: random_number = randint (0, len Extract the ZIP into a file. Here are listed some examples of python-random-name-generator usege. Camelcase is a naming protocol for giving file or attribute names that contain more than one word joined that all start with a capital letter. Python import random_name_generator as rng # Generate 2 english male names rng. If you are using Python version less than 3. To execute a generator function, we assign it to the generator variable. Create good names for games, profiles, brands or social networks. get_full_name()) returns for examples: April Reiter Emory Miller David Ballin Alice Trotter Virginia Rios Thomas Wheeler James Harrell Nicolas White Mary Flanagan Velda Grubb Create random male names for i in range(10): rand_name = names. Explore your training options in 10 minutes Get Matched. The first bit of code grabs a disctionary Colorful Ball Python Names. import random first_names= ('John','Andy','Joe') last_names= ('Johnson','Smith','Williams') names = [] for i in range (3): names. gen ()) Example 2: random name generator python import random import time print ('WARNING: If you want less than 10 names, too bad you cant. Open a program such as Visual Studio Code. Amethyst. Here’s some code to show how next (), and yield, work. There’s a few more features if importing as a Python package: generate random last name or generate random first name (with or without specifying gender), generate random full name (also without or without gender). Browse Bootcamps I am new to Python. org> drf-generators (0. Names can be used as a command line utility or imported as a Python package. Create a function called “showMeMultipleBabyNames” two parameters: “numOfNames”, “gender”. Today we got a quiz about function: "Take a text and a word as input and passes them to a function called search(); The search() function should return 'Word found' if the word is present in the text, or 'Word not found', if it's not. In the previous code, we activate the function multiply (), and assign it to a On Career Karma, learn how to write a Python generator. If the 3rd letter is a vowel, return the first 4 letters. The next () function takes the generator as input and executes the generator function the names will display in different lines, use the split library to clear the blank spaces and print to confirm, you can spot the difference. Along with this, we will discuss Python Generator Expressions, Python list vs generator, and Python Function vs Generators. # generator object with next () myList =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] def square_generator(input_list): for element in input_list: print("Returning the square of next element:",element) yield element*element print("The input list is:",myList) gen = square_generator(myList) for i in range(10): print("Accessing square of next element from generator. SystemRandom(). 2022-04-25 - Sandro Tosi <morph@debian. join (names) output. Upload the file to VS Code. Create I want to generate usernames based on: Last 3 letters of a first name. If the 3rd letter is a consonant, return the first 3 letters. If the string is less than 4 characters,… Read More »How to create a Nickname Generator in Python A simple python script to generate random names. A = random. So let’s go ahead and take a closer look at Generators in Python. Generator objects are used either by calling the next method on the generator object or using the generator object in a “for in” loop (as shown in the above program). Step 1: Get into the Python environment Alright, let’s go ahead and get this party started. Generate a random code name with the code name generator. Aqua / Aquamarine. The name camelcase comes from its look, which resembles the back of generate python Ken Sykora # A generator-function is defined like a normal function, # but whenever it needs to generate a value, # it does so with the yield keyword rather than return. Today, in this Python Generator tutorial, we will study what is a generator in Python Programming. But, in Python, the implementation of this painful task just gets really smooth. GitHub Gist: instantly share code, notes, and snippets. # A Python program to demonstrate use of. Even more if you use a translator or the AI Example 1: random name generator in python import namegenerator #First Do pip install namegenerator #The Import it print (namegenerator. 6. Yield 10. 5. append (line. Create random names with python. Based on project statistics from the GitHub repository for the PyPI package python-random-name-generator, we found that it has been starred ? times, and First we're going to set the first letter of our user name name to be a capital. Step 3: Generate your questions Generate random names. Generator-Object : Generator functions return a generator object. You can set this number to anything you want or name the variable you store it in Python name generator. Where gen () is the name of a generator, every time the yield is called, it returns the value to be displayed. generate python Ken Sykora # A generator-function is defined like a normal function, # but whenever it needs to generate a value, # it does so with the yield keyword rather than return. choice() python generator object. I used pyenv to download Python 3. I want to generate usernames based on: Last 3 letters of a first name. Viewed 3k times 4 \$\begingroup\$ This is a basic name generator I random name generator in python. choice() I want to generate usernames based on: Last 3 letters of a first name. First 3 letters of a last name. Learning a basic consept of Python program with best example. [ Debian Janitor ] * Update standards version to 4. Subscribe. A generator must have at least one yield statement. Run the code. dom The challenge Write a function, nicknameGenerator that takes a string name as an argument and returns the first 3 or 4 letters as a nickname. Installation. This is a fantasy name generator I wrote as part of a fantasy combat game I'm writing for t_games. strip ()) return new_list # call the function three times to transform names from each # file into arrays file = "male_first_names. Well, okay, it's two lists. list comprehension is a concise, elegant way to generate lists in a line of code. However I am unsure how to parse the text file effectively with readline(). 7. Supports multi-ethnical generation. dom In our last Python Tutorial, we studied Python functions. secret. Viewed 3k times 4 \$\begingroup\$ This is a basic name generator I 1 2 3. randint(1,10) print(a) output: 2. 6 you can use the secrets module to generate a secure random password. Where python3 is a keyword used, we have used the path of a file having the What is a Python Generator (Textbook Definition) A Python generator is a function which returns a generator iterator (just an object we can iterate over) by calling yield . All of these credentials were created as purley fictional names. randint method. Direct Usage Popularity. Hello everyone! My boyfriend and I don't have any cs background and currently we are learning python together. The Code Name Generator is perfect for fantasy, spy or writing projects. 6, then use the random. call the first function (“giveMeBabyName”) from here. Modified 5 years, 2 months ago. Submit your funny nicknames and cool gamertags and copy the best from the list. None of these credentials, addresses, names, ages or others are meant to replicate a person’s actual personal credentials. Then we use the next () method to execute the generator function. ') name1 = input ('please enter the first name: ') print (' ') name2 = input ('please enter #randomname #python #pythonprogramming #module #programming #coding Machine Problem Random Module in Python1. choice (first_name) names. " In the quick video, I show you how to generate random names in Python. To use the script from the command line: Python Generators with Examples A generator is a kind of function that returns an object called a generator object which can return a series of values rather than a single value. choice () random. Random-Name-Generator Using Python -Tkinter program for student, beginner and beginners and professionals. It's mostly European mythology or fantasy fiction, although I threw in some others if they fit the two syllable format. Where python3 is a keyword used, we have used the path of a file having the how to make a python program to generate usernames based on the last 3 letters of name & first 3 letters of surname and the year a student in enrolled. def multiply (num): mult = num * 52 yield mult add = mult + 185 yield add subt = add - 76 yield subt test = multiply (6) print (next (test)) print (next (test)) print (next (test)) # Result 312 497 421. Useful for unit testing and automation. dom Name Generator will do what its name says, generate names for you. On Career Karma, learn how to write a Python generator. This program help improve student basic fandament and logics. Even normal-looking ball pythons are beautiful serpents, but modern keepers have a kaleidoscope of colors to choose from. So, let’s start the Python Generator Tutorial. for example, 1. gen ()) import random import time print ('WARNING: If you want less than 10 names, too bad you cant. If you need a refresher on user defined functions lesson in Python here is a link to our Fake is a handy Python package that generates fake names, addresses, and text. get_full_name(gender='male') print(rand_name) There is only one feature available from the command line currently: generate a single random full name. py’. But I am not able to understand . Generators are typically defined with the def keyword.


Best replica jerseys reddit, Boarding school california, Bul armory viper holster, Bentley bmw manual, Carlinkit hardware error bt, Bulloch interweb arrests, A level chemistry specification edexcel, Beats headphones klarna, Best firewall reddit, Adsl bridge, Adp in, Batocera 4k, Channels like miami tv, A12 police incident today, Blur correctly filters 3x3 image, Art write for us, Blockchair login, Aphrodite planet name, Big boy tsr 250 for sale, Being lied to by someone you love, Centenary mill preston rent 1 bed, 24 hour mobile mechanic near me, Blade server size, Child cruelty charge california, Best succulents for indoors, Avengers x reader therapy, Bitdefender update, 6x6x12 treated post menards, Ambot conversion, Best traditional karate gi, Brzi zajam novca, 1x6 lumber, 350z exhaust manifold, Are tenant buyouts taxable, Ace hardware automotive paint, 2013 vw passat software update, 1998 bayliner capri 1950 specs, Appendix carry holster cz p07, Canik tp9sfx ejector spring, Accident route 3 nj yesterday, 30reozjb kohler generator manual, Agricultural land for rent near me, Audiology cpt codes 2022, 1972 nova ss for sale craigslist, Cedar hill city jail, 410 barrel liner, Capital one spanish assessment, Baffle designs, Asus rog zephyrus g14 3060, 2006 bmw 330xi service manual, Blue dye pregnancy test positive, Acrylic afterpay, 2021 polaris slingshot for sale texas, Car speakers with good bass no amp, Cavite job hiring, 2005 chevrolet cobalt value, Aldi frozen vegetables price, Async mpsc, Best virtual mailbox, Amber alert florida yesterday, Calories in 200g boiled potatoes without skin, 36x18x36 terrarium, 2005 cummins bosch injectors, Book of moses pdf, 1920s gangster names generator, 900cc motorcycles, Abate meaning in tamil, Am radio tuning circuit, Bms connection, Catawba county voting guide, Beagle freedom project youtube, Biqu h2 heat creep, Blair script pastebin, Autotask pricing reddit, Best gem for rapier dex, Basf chemicals, Aggravated assault on a public servant texas sentence, Charlottesville vice, Apr stage 2 golf gti mk6, Check duplicates in excel, Adb failed to connect, Best vintage audiophile speakers, Asphalt 6 jar 480x800, 250cc scooter street legal, Bathroom floor tiles ideas, Best clean rap albums, Affordable custom home builders indianapolis, Barclays qa salary, 51 inch net wrap for sale, 2005 gibson sg special faded cherry, Chain link anchor, C2bit, Ccsd transfer application, Aht10 adafruit, 1957 chevys for sale on craigslist, 2020 supra spoiler for sale, Beasts enstars, Ambibox plugins, A man of mass 80 kg stands on a plank of mass 40 kg, Cbre associate salary, \